summary refs log tree commit diff
diff options
context:
space:
mode:
authorJaka Hudoklin <jakahudoklin@gmail.com>2014-08-29 17:45:05 +0200
committerJaka Hudoklin <jakahudoklin@gmail.com>2014-08-29 17:48:49 +0200
commitec9d2e6f2b16601e167574f366544fdb7dcea864 (patch)
treeb264686d92bc89fbec2c436d800a1558bfbcf520
parentac73fbcda96d01b26c3be3eb87d718d5e9a0ef73 (diff)
downloadnixlib-ec9d2e6f2b16601e167574f366544fdb7dcea864.tar
nixlib-ec9d2e6f2b16601e167574f366544fdb7dcea864.tar.gz
nixlib-ec9d2e6f2b16601e167574f366544fdb7dcea864.tar.bz2
nixlib-ec9d2e6f2b16601e167574f366544fdb7dcea864.tar.lz
nixlib-ec9d2e6f2b16601e167574f366544fdb7dcea864.tar.xz
nixlib-ec9d2e6f2b16601e167574f366544fdb7dcea864.tar.zst
nixlib-ec9d2e6f2b16601e167574f366544fdb7dcea864.zip
mongodb: darwin support
-rw-r--r--pkgs/servers/nosql/mongodb/default.nix5
1 files changed, 2 insertions, 3 deletions
diff --git a/pkgs/servers/nosql/mongodb/default.nix b/pkgs/servers/nosql/mongodb/default.nix
index f51a2b8fe3f8..4935b7388608 100644
--- a/pkgs/servers/nosql/mongodb/default.nix
+++ b/pkgs/servers/nosql/mongodb/default.nix
@@ -2,14 +2,13 @@
 
 let version = "2.6.4";
     system-libraries = [
-      "tcmalloc"
       "pcre"
       "boost"
       "snappy"
       # "v8"      -- mongo still bundles 3.12 and does not work with 3.15+
       # "stemmer" -- not nice to package yet (no versioning, no makefile, no shared libs)
       # "yaml"    -- it seems nixpkgs' yamlcpp (0.5.1) is problematic for mongo
-    ];
+    ] ++ stdenv.lib.optionals (!stdenv.isDarwin) [ "tcmalloc" ];
     system-lib-args = stdenv.lib.concatStringsSep " "
                           (map (lib: "--use-system-${lib}") system-libraries);
 
@@ -43,6 +42,6 @@ in stdenv.mkDerivation rec {
     license = stdenv.lib.licenses.agpl3;
 
     maintainers = [ stdenv.lib.maintainers.bluescreen303 ];
-    platforms = stdenv.lib.platforms.linux;
+    platforms = stdenv.lib.platforms.unix;
   };
 }